Factors Affecting Cost
- Type of Drainage System: The specific system you need, whether it's a French drain, surface drain, or subsurface drain, will impact the cost.
- Soil Type: Different soil types can affect the complexity and duration of the installation process.
- Property Size: Larger properties may require more extensive drainage systems, leading to higher costs.
- Depth of Installation: Deeper installations generally require more labor and materials.
- Permit Requirements: Local regulations and the need for permits can add to the total cost.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may increase labor costs due to the added difficulty.
- Materials Used: The quality and type of materials, such as piping and gravel, can vary in price.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Fort Smith, AR, will influence the overall cost.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(Fort Smith, AR) |
---|---|
French Drain Installation | $2,000 - $6,000 |
Surface Drain Installation | $1,500 - $4,500 |
Subsurface Drain Installation | $3,000 - $7,000 |
Trench Digging | $500 - $1,500 per 100 feet |
Permitting Fees | $100 - $500 |
Soil Testing | $300 - $700 |
Material Costs (Piping, Gravel) | $500 - $2,000 |
Labor Costs | $50 - $100 per hour |
